David Knox is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Sociology and Political Science and Gender Studies. According to data from OpenAlex, David Knox has authored 86 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Social Psychology, 33 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 20 papers in Gender Studies. Recurrent topics in David Knox’s work include Attachment and Relationship Dynamics (22 papers), Adolescent Sexual and Reproductive Health (13 papers) and Sexuality, Behavior, and Technology (12 papers). David Knox is often cited by papers focused on Attachment and Relationship Dynamics (22 papers), Adolescent Sexual and Reproductive Health (13 papers) and Sexuality, Behavior, and Technology (12 papers). David Knox coll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Kenya. David Knox's co-authors include Marty E. Zusman, Karen Vail‐Smith, Michael J. Sporakowski, Sloane C. Burke, Penny F. Langhammer, Lincoln Fishpool, Thomas M. Brooks, Kenneth Wilson, Matt Foster and Paul Salaman and has published in prestigious journals such as BioScience, Computers in Human Behavior and Journal of Marriage and Family.
